About the team

The administrative team works with Stripe’s leaders to support their day-to-day administrative and operational needs.

What you’ll do

In this role, you will be a critical part of supporting our business function.

Responsibilities

  • Provide complex and proactive calendar support for multiple leaders
  • Make recommendations for your leaders with regard to their time management, prioritization, delegation, and organization
  • Coordinate domestic and international travel and manage all related details  
  • Prepare and submit expense reports on behalf of your leaders

Minimum requirements

  • You are incredibly organized, with superb attention to detail and a strong ability to execute
  • You are excellent with time management and able to quickly shift tasks and priorities as needed
  • You have a knack for working across various roles and teams in a fast-paced, changing environment while remaining flexible, proactive, resourceful, and efficient
  • You communicate, perform, and react well under pressure or ambiguity
  • You are adept at handling sensitive information and situations with care and confidence
  • You are able to anticipate and respond to the needs of others before they arise
  • Previous 1+ years of administrative experience
  • Business proficiency in written and spoken English

Preferred qualifications

  • Experience with Google Suite
  • Experience supporting multiple complex calendars
  • Experience booking and managing both domestic and international travel arrangements
  • Experience with expense reporting
